Since 2016, as Managing Director, he and co-founder Chris Retzler have led Mocean Energy in developing novel ocean energy technologies with applications in O&G, power for islands, and other sectors. He has a Master of Ocean Engineering from Oregon State University and a PhD from the University of Edinburgh. Before undertaking these post-graduate studies, Cameron worked as a naval architect writing software for ship simulations.

He is an internationally known specialist in coastal and marine processes with 30 years of postdoctoral experience. His areas of expertise include sediment transport, scour around structures, coastal erosion, and beach management. He has worked on projects in over 20 countries in Europe, the Middle East, Asia-Pacific, Africa, and the Americas.
